The Power of a Strong Defense

They say a great defense is the foundation of every successful team. History backs this up. Some of the greatest Champions League-winning sides leaned on rock-solid defenses to carry them through.

Take Chelsea in 2021, for example. Under Thomas Tuchel, they conceded only four goals in the entire knockout stage. Their ability to shut down attacking giants like Real Madrid and Manchester City played a huge role in their triumph.

A well-drilled defense can frustrate even the most dangerous attackers. Tight marking, disciplined positioning, and relentless pressing make it nearly impossible for the opposition to create clear chances.

Key Defensive Strategies That Could Win the Final

- Compact Defensive Shape: Teams often sit deep and stay compact to neutralize fast attacks.
- High Pressing: Winning the ball high up the pitch can prevent counterattacks before they start.
- Set-Piece Organization: Many finals are decided on set pieces—one mistake can be fatal.
- Elite Goalkeeping: A world-class keeper can be the difference between victory and heartbreak.

The Case for a Ruthless Attack

Sure, defense is crucial, but you won't win a final if you can't put the ball in the net. A solid defense keeps you in games, but an elite attack wins them.

Look at the legendary Barcelona team of 2015. With Messi, Neymar, and Suárez up front, they outscored everyone on their way to lifting the trophy. No matter how good the opposition's defense was, they just couldn’t stop them.

Goals change games—it’s that simple. A single moment of brilliance up front can break down even the best defenses.

Key Attacking Tactics That Can Make the Difference

- Quick Transitions: Catching defenses off guard with fast breaks can be lethal.
- Fluid Movement: Attackers switching positions make it harder for defenders to mark them.
- Set-Piece Efficiency: Corners and free kicks often decide tight finals.
- Clinical Finishing: In a final, you might only get one or two chances—you have to take them.

Recent Finals: What Decided the Winner?

Looking at past finals can give us clues about what might happen this year.

- 2023: Manchester City 1-0 Inter Milan – A defensive masterclass from City but decided by a single attacking breakthrough.
- 2022: Real Madrid 1-0 Liverpool – Courtois' heroics in goal kept Madrid alive, showing how vital an elite defense is.
- 2021: Chelsea 1-0 Manchester City – Defense-first approach won the day, with Tuchel's side shutting down Pep’s attack.
- 2020: Bayern Munich 1-0 PSG – A mix of solid defending and a clinical attack sealed Bayern’s victory.

The X-Factors: What Else Could Decide the Final?

While the offense vs. defense debate is fascinating, other factors often play a huge role in a Champions League final.

Midfield Control

The battle in the middle of the park is crucial. The team that controls possession and dictates the tempo often gains the upper hand.

Individual Brilliance

A moment of magic from a superstar—whether it’s a last-minute goal, an incredible save, or a game-changing tackle—can be the difference.

Tactical Adjustments

Managers who make the right in-game changes can turn the tide of a final. Whether it’s bringing on a super-sub or tweaking a formation, tactics matter.

Mental Toughness

Finals are high-pressure environments. The team that handles nerves better and stays mentally strong usually emerges victorious.
